The few which do care, should be only created on PF, and mapped within GGTT. On VFs, mapping at fixed offset is prohibited, as each VF is granted access to a range of GGTT address space. Since fixed addresses of GGTT mapping can only be used on PF, add an assert which makes sure no attempt of fixed placement will happen for a driver probed on a VF.
